Overview of research project
This study is situated in uMkhanyakude district, K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a (SA) where the Africa Health Research Institute (AHRI) conducts annual surveillance through its Population Intervention Platform (PIP). The overarching aim of the study is to investigate the effect of non-pharmacological public health response to COVID-19 on the health and well-being of school-going children in uMkhanyakude district and mobilise existing community and school resources to co-develop a whole-school preparedness response toolkit to COVID-19 in schools.
